The Museum of BBQ in Kansas City, MO, offers an immersive experience into the world of barbecue, showcasing its history, flavors, and regional styles. Visitors can engage with interactive exhibits and discover how pitmasters transform tough cuts into delectable bites.
At the museum, guests can explore the main American barbecue regions, including the Carolinas, Memphis, Texas, and Kansas City, all while enjoying a feast for the senses. With a curated collection of sauces and rubs available, the Museum of BBQ invites everyone to find their forever sauce and add some flavor to their plates.
